Understanding the Importance of Minyan in Jewish Tradition



What Is a Minyan?


A minyan is the quorum of ten Jewish adults required for certain religious obligations, particularly communal prayers. This group typically comprises ten men in Orthodox communities and can include both men and women in other denominations, such as Conservative and Reform Judaism, depending on local customs.

Why Is Minyan Critical?


Participating in a minyan is essential for performing several religious rituals, including:
- Kaddish (mourner’s prayer)
- Kedushah (sanctification)
- Tachanun
- Reading from the Torah (Aliyah)
- Reciting certain blessings collectively

The communal aspect of minyan fosters unity and spiritual connection, emphasizing that prayer is a collective act rather than an individual one.
